Jane was the widow of John Peter Rucker, who died in NYC June 1788, by whom she had one son. She became the second wife of Alexander Macomb.Sr in July of 1791. They had seven children. She was buried with him in Georgetown Presbyterian Old Burying Ground and was reintered at ANC on May 12 1892 when the Georgetown cemetery was closed. Her name is on the bottom half of the stone, her husband's on the top.
